Roles & Responsibilities
- Perform CT examinations with care and precision, delivering high-quality diagnostic images
- Position and prepare patients for scanning while ensuring comfort and safety
- Operate CT equipment according to protocol and maintain strict radiation safety practices
- Complete required documentation and charting accurately and in a timely manner
- Follow infection control procedures and facility-specific health requirements
- Participate in competency assessments such as the Trinity Skills Checklist
- Communicate clearly with radiologists, nursing staff, and patients to support excellent care
- Maintain equipment readiness and report any technical issues promptly
Qualifications
- CT modality experience (CT listed as core skill) — able to perform CT imaging confidently
- BLS certification (required)
- License/certificate verification as required by state and facility
- Completion of Trinity Skills Checklist and facility competency requirements
- Ability to pass pre-employment health requirements: fit test, Trinity 10-panel drug screen, and required immunizations
- Up-to-date immunizations and health clearance (COVID-19 vaccine, MMR, Hepatitis B, Influenza, Varicella, 2-step PPD or IGRA, physical/health statement)
